** The Ford repair market for Stringtown, Oklahoma, is characteristic of a rural area, where specialized services are concentrated in nearby larger towns. Stringtown itself lacks a dedicated Ford-specific dealership or specialist. Therefore, residents primarily rely on service centers in Atoka (~10 miles away) and McAlester (~25 miles away). The competition level is moderate, with a handful of reputable shops dominating the market. The average quality of service is good, with shops like Atoka Auto & Diesel offering deep technical expertise, while franchises like Christian Brothers Automotive provide a premium, customer-focused experience. Pricing is generally competitive and reflective of a rural market, typically lower than major metropolitan areas, with general maintenance starting around $90-$125/hour and specialized diesel or transmission work commanding higher rates. For highly complex issues or performance tuning, owners may need to travel to larger cities like Durant or Texoma.
